Uchelgais Gogledd Cymru | Ambition North Wales is seeking a Head of PMO Delivery to lead the operations of the Portfolio Management Office and drive the delivery of the North Wales Growth Deal. This pivotal role involves working closely with stakeholders to ensure effective portfolio delivery aligned with the organization's vision for economic well-being.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in managing complex programmes, exceptional leadership abilities, and a commitment to public service excellence.
